Better control of what artifacts are built by what task
This commit is contained in:
@@ -4,21 +4,20 @@ task buildJars(type: Exec) {
|
||||
outputs.dir('libs')
|
||||
commandLine 'ant', 'preparebotelibs'
|
||||
}
|
||||
compileJava.dependsOn buildJars
|
||||
|
||||
// TODO an empty botejars.jar is added to the classpath
|
||||
|
||||
artifacts {
|
||||
'default' file('libs/i2p.jar')
|
||||
'default' file('libs/router.jar')
|
||||
'default' file('libs/mstreaming.jar')
|
||||
'default' file('libs/streaming.jar')
|
||||
'default' file('libs/bcprov-ecc-jdk16-146.jar')
|
||||
'default' file('libs/flexi-gmss-1.7p1.jar')
|
||||
'default' file('libs/lzma-9.20.jar')
|
||||
'default' file('libs/ntruenc-1.2.jar')
|
||||
'default' file('libs/scrypt-1.4.0.jar')
|
||||
'default' file('libs/i2pbote.jar')
|
||||
'default' file: file('libs/i2p.jar'), builtBy: buildJars
|
||||
'default' file: file('libs/router.jar'), builtBy: buildJars
|
||||
'default' file: file('libs/mstreaming.jar'), builtBy: buildJars
|
||||
'default' file: file('libs/streaming.jar'), builtBy: buildJars
|
||||
'default' file: file('libs/bcprov-ecc-jdk16-146.jar'), builtBy: buildJars
|
||||
'default' file: file('libs/flexi-gmss-1.7p1.jar'), builtBy: buildJars
|
||||
'default' file: file('libs/lzma-9.20.jar'), builtBy: buildJars
|
||||
'default' file: file('libs/ntruenc-1.2.jar'), builtBy: buildJars
|
||||
'default' file: file('libs/scrypt-1.4.0.jar'), builtBy: buildJars
|
||||
'default' file: file('libs/i2pbote.jar'), builtBy: buildJars
|
||||
}
|
||||
|
||||
clean.dependsOn cleanBuildJars
|
||||
|
||||
Reference in New Issue
Block a user